Come and enjoy the historic, rustic ambience of Tyford House in Dongara. The house has two bedrooms both with ensuites and can sleep 5. A comfy lounge room and numerous outdoor areas to enjoy. A food preparation area is included in the lounge and on the verandah is a barbeque area, in addition to a firepit to enjoy. We are with in walking distance of the main street in Dongara with coffee shops, restaurants, supermarket and the historic Dongara Hotel, only 3 minutes drive to the closest beach and 8 minutes drive to Dongara’s iconic South Beach, with the marina enroute. Also walking distance to the start of river/estuary/beach walking trails.

A unique opportunity to stay at this lovely Historic House, great location, helpful friendly hosts. Thanks Fiona & Anton, we really enjoyed staying in Tyford House , wish it could’ve been for longer. Would love to stay again & will recommend to friends & family.
Amenities are good for kids as there is a big paddock out back to run around in and kick the footy. Place is cool during the day and at night, bathrooms are huge and so is the BBQ. Great older style homestay accommodation with comfy beds.
This is a truly magnificent house, and beautifully furnished and presented. The only thing that made it awkward, was that the kitchen didn't have a sink. "The kitchen" is literally what's in the photo of a fridge with a dresser, mini oven and microwave, in the lounge room.It's also on Brand Highway. You can hear the passing trucks if you're a light sleeper. However, it's in a perfect location to explore the area, or for a night stopover on the way north.
In a word Quirky, a mix of 200yr old building and tasteful expensive furniture, would recommend this property,and thanks to the host, a lot of work has gone into this. WELL DONE
